Thai police go undercover as lion dancers to catch thief

Officers devise unusual plan to arrest man suspected of stealing about $64,000 worth of Buddhist artefacts

Thai police donned a lion costume during this week’s lunar new year festivities to arrest a man accused of stealing about $64,000 worth of Buddhist artefacts.

Dressed as a red-and-yellow lion, officers made the arrest on Wednesday evening after responding to a report this month of a home burglary in the suburbs of Bangkok.
